Phallogaster

provided by wikipedia EN

Phallogaster is a fungal genus in the family Phallogastraceae. The genus is monotypic, containing the single secotioid species Phallogaster saccatus,[1] commonly known as the club-shaped stinkhorn or the stink poke.[2]
